How Reliable is the Mitsubishi Shogun Sport?

Based on 312,897 MOT tests across 18,006 vehicles.

72.1%
Pass Rate
6,293
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
18,006
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Anti-roll bar r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ement 13,017
Anti-roll bar has excessive play in a pin/bush 12,518
Brake pipe excessively corroded 11,821
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 7,032
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 6,914

AK02 UWZ is a 2002 Mitsubishi Shogun Sport in Silver with a 2,477c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.6%.

Across all 2002 Mitsubishi Shogun Sport models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.2% with a typical mileage of 87,807 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i Shogun Sport fails its MOT is anti-roll bar r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ement, accounting for 13,017 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K02 UWZ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i Shogun Sport typ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 24 years old, this Mitsubishi Shogun Sport is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
